Simple rooms above a popular restaurant. Functional but not flash, but decent location right in midst of Oxford Street. The Lebanese breakfast is the highlight.

Frankie's, situated in Osu on the bustling Oxford Street, evokes nostalgia for anyone who grew up in the 90s. Visiting there to relive those childhood memories is certainly worthwhile. I particularly enjoy their pies, especially the fish and chicken pie available at their roadside stand at Osu. Recently, they have expanded with mini-stands at various locations in Accra, primarily selling snacks. 1)Customer Service: (Could Do Better) The staff at the Osu location are friendly, but they tend not to engage customers bedore/after a purchase. For instance, if you are unsure about which ice cream flavor to select, they won’t offer any recommendations or assistance. This lack of engagement feels somewhat unwelcoming. However, the staff at their pie stand downstairs are always friendly and do an excellent job! 2)Food: As previously mentioned, I only visit Frankies for their ice cream and pies. Honestly, I don’t find anything particularly exceptional or unique about their ice cream flavors. Nowadays, you can find similar offerings at any ice cream shop. 3)Bitter Experience: Pick-Up Station/Snack Bar (American House) After making a purchase at their mini-stand on American House Lane, I encountered an unfriendly staff member. When I inquired, "Which of the pies would you recommend?" she simply replied that they were all nice, without even a smile. It felt as if I was bothering her by trying to make a purchase. It appeared she was preoccupied with setting up the juices and that I was wasting her time.
